Understanding the Basics of Plastic Extrusion



Plastic extrusion, a staple in the production sector, is a procedure that includes melting raw plastic product and improving it into a constant profile. The elegance of plastic extrusion lies in its adaptability. The choice of plastic and the layout of the die determine the product's characteristics.

Cost-efficient Product Production



A substantial advantage of plastic extrusion is its impressive cost-effectiveness. This production process permits constant, high-volume production with minimal waste, which converts into reduced prices. The raw materials used, normally plastic pellets, are fairly cost-effective compared to other substances (plastic extrusion). The process itself requires less power than several other manufacturing techniques, additionally reducing expenses. Furthermore, the extrusion procedure enables for a high degree of accuracy in forming the plastic, minimizing the requirement for expensive post-production modifications or adjustments. Moreover, the toughness and long life of extruded plastic products frequently suggest less require for replacements, adding to long-term cost savings. All these elements make plastic extrusion a highly economical selection for several projects, providing an eye-catching equilibrium in between price and efficiency.

Evaluating the Environmental Impact of Plastic Extrusion



While understanding layout restrictions is a considerable facet of plastic extrusion, it is just as crucial to consider its environmental effects. The procedure of plastic extrusion entails melting plastic materials, possibly releasing hazardous gases right into the atmosphere. Better, the resulting products are frequently non-biodegradable, adding to land fill waste. Nevertheless, innovations in innovation have actually enabled even more environmentally-friendly practices. As an example, utilizing recycled plastic products in the extrusion procedure can decrease ecological effect. Additionally, creating biodegradable plastic alternatives can help reduce waste problems. Evaluating these environmental variables is important when implementing plastic extrusion projects, guaranteeing an equilibrium in between efficiency, cost-effectiveness, and environmental duty.
